/kernel/linux/linux-6.6/drivers/usb/host/ |
H A D | Makefile | [all...] |
H A D | xhci-dbg.c | 13 char *xhci_get_slot_state(struct xhci_hcd *xhci, in xhci_get_slot_state() argument 22 void xhci_dbg_trace(struct xhci_hcd *xhci, void (*trace)(struct va_format *), in xhci_dbg_trace() argument
|
H A D | xhci-mvebu.c | 79 struct xhci_hcd *xhci = hcd_to_xhci(hcd); in xhci_mvebu_a3700_init_quirk() local
|
H A D | xhci-ext-caps.c | 28 static int xhci_create_intel_xhci_sw_pdev(struct xhci_hcd *xhci, u32 cap_offset) in xhci_create_intel_xhci_sw_pdev() argument 84 int xhci_ext_cap_init(struct xhci_hcd *xhci) in xhci_ext_cap_init() argument
|
H A D | xhci-dbgtty.c | 492 int xhci_dbc_tty_probe(struct device *dev, void __iomem *base, struct xhci_hcd *xhci) in xhci_dbc_tty_probe() argument
|
H A D | xhci-histb.c | 193 struct xhci_hcd *xhci; in xhci_histb_probe() local 316 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_histb_remove() local 338 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_histb_suspend() local 353 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_histb_resume() local [all...] |
H A D | xhci-plat.c | 77 static void xhci_plat_quirks(struct device *dev, struct xhci_hcd *xhci) in xhci_plat_quirks() argument 146 struct xhci_hcd *xhci; xhci_plat_probe() local 408 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_remove() local 442 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_suspend() local 470 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_resume_common() local 521 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_runtime_suspend() local 534 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_runtime_resume() local [all...] |
H A D | xhci-debugfs.h | 123 static inline void xhci_debugfs_init(struct xhci_hcd *xhci) { } in xhci_debugfs_init() argument 124 static inline void xhci_debugfs_exit(struct xhci_hcd *xhci) { } in xhci_debugfs_exit() argument 130 xhci_debugfs_create_endpoint(struct xhci_hcd *xhci, struct xhci_virt_device *virt_dev, int ep_index) xhci_debugfs_create_endpoint() argument 134 xhci_debugfs_remove_endpoint(struct xhci_hcd *xhci, struct xhci_virt_device *virt_dev, int ep_index) xhci_debugfs_remove_endpoint() argument 138 xhci_debugfs_create_stream_files(struct xhci_hcd *xhci, struct xhci_virt_device *virt_dev, int ep_index) xhci_debugfs_create_stream_files() argument [all...] |
/kernel/linux/linux-5.10/drivers/usb/host/ |
H A D | Makefile | [all...] |
H A D | xhci-dbg.c | 13 char *xhci_get_slot_state(struct xhci_hcd *xhci, in xhci_get_slot_state() argument 22 void xhci_dbg_trace(struct xhci_hcd *xhci, void (*trace)(struct va_format *), in xhci_dbg_trace() argument
|
H A D | xhci-ext-caps.c | 28 static int xhci_create_intel_xhci_sw_pdev(struct xhci_hcd *xhci, u32 cap_offset) in xhci_create_intel_xhci_sw_pdev() argument 83 int xhci_ext_cap_init(struct xhci_hcd *xhci) in xhci_ext_cap_init() argument
|
H A D | xhci-mvebu.c | 80 struct xhci_hcd *xhci = hcd_to_xhci(hcd); in xhci_mvebu_a3700_plat_setup() local 121 struct xhci_hcd *xhci = hcd_to_xhci(hcd); in xhci_mvebu_a3700_init_quirk() local
|
H A D | xhci-dbgtty.c | 471 int xhci_dbc_tty_probe(struct xhci_hcd *xhci) in xhci_dbc_tty_probe() argument
|
H A D | xhci-histb.c | 167 static void xhci_histb_quirks(struct device *dev, struct xhci_hcd *xhci) in xhci_histb_quirks() argument 203 struct xhci_hcd *xhci; in xhci_histb_probe() local 326 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_histb_remove() local 350 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_histb_suspend() local 365 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_histb_resume() local [all...] |
H A D | xhci-plat.c | 87 static void xhci_plat_quirks(struct device *dev, struct xhci_hcd *xhci) in xhci_plat_quirks() argument 192 struct xhci_hcd *xhci; xhci_plat_probe() local 411 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_remove() local 440 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_suspend() local 468 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_resume() local 509 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_runtime_suspend() local 522 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_plat_runtime_resume() local [all...] |
H A D | xhci-debugfs.h | 123 static inline void xhci_debugfs_init(struct xhci_hcd *xhci) { } in xhci_debugfs_init() argument 124 static inline void xhci_debugfs_exit(struct xhci_hcd *xhci) { } in xhci_debugfs_exit() argument 130 xhci_debugfs_create_endpoint(struct xhci_hcd *xhci, struct xhci_virt_device *virt_dev, int ep_index) xhci_debugfs_create_endpoint() argument 134 xhci_debugfs_remove_endpoint(struct xhci_hcd *xhci, struct xhci_virt_device *virt_dev, int ep_index) xhci_debugfs_remove_endpoint() argument 138 xhci_debugfs_create_stream_files(struct xhci_hcd *xhci, struct xhci_virt_device *virt_dev, int ep_index) xhci_debugfs_create_stream_files() argument [all...] |
H A D | xhci-mtk.c | 381 static void xhci_mtk_quirks(struct device *dev, struct xhci_hcd *xhci) in xhci_mtk_quirks() argument 442 struct xhci_hcd *xhci; xhci_mtk_probe() local 601 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_mtk_remove() local 632 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_mtk_suspend() local 650 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_mtk_resume() local [all...] |
H A D | xhci-hub.c | 55 static int xhci_create_usb3_bos_desc(struct xhci_hcd *xhci, char *buf, in xhci_create_usb3_bos_desc() argument 169 xhci_common_hub_descriptor(struct xhci_hcd *xhci, struct usb_hub_descriptor *desc, int ports) xhci_common_hub_descriptor() argument 192 xhci_usb2_hub_descriptor(struct usb_hcd *hcd, struct xhci_hcd *xhci, struct usb_hub_descriptor *desc) xhci_usb2_hub_descriptor() argument 247 xhci_usb3_hub_descriptor(struct usb_hcd *hcd, struct xhci_hcd *xhci, struct usb_hub_descriptor *desc) xhci_usb3_hub_descriptor() argument 280 xhci_hub_descriptor(struct usb_hcd *hcd, struct xhci_hcd *xhci, struct usb_hub_descriptor *desc) xhci_hub_descriptor() argument 361 xhci_find_slot_id_by_port(struct usb_hcd *hcd, struct xhci_hcd *xhci, u16 port) xhci_find_slot_id_by_port() argument 389 xhci_stop_device(struct xhci_hcd *xhci, int slot_id, int suspend) xhci_stop_device() argument 462 xhci_ring_device(struct xhci_hcd *xhci, int slot_id) xhci_ring_device() argument 481 xhci_disable_port(struct usb_hcd *hcd, struct xhci_hcd *xhci, u16 wIndex, __le32 __iomem *addr, u32 port_status) xhci_disable_port() argument 504 xhci_clear_port_change_bit(struct xhci_hcd *xhci, u16 wValue, u16 wIndex, __le32 __iomem *addr, u32 port_status) xhci_clear_port_change_bit() argument 557 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_get_rhub() local 604 xhci_port_set_test_mode(struct xhci_hcd *xhci, u16 test_mode, u16 wIndex) xhci_port_set_test_mode() argument 663 xhci_exit_test_mode(struct xhci_hcd *xhci) xhci_exit_test_mode() argument 682 xhci_set_link_state(struct xhci_hcd *xhci, struct xhci_port *port, u32 link_state) xhci_set_link_state() argument 699 xhci_set_remote_wake_mask(struct xhci_hcd *xhci, struct xhci_port *port, u16 wake_mask) xhci_set_remote_wake_mask() argument 726 xhci_test_and_clear_bit(struct xhci_hcd *xhci, struct xhci_port *port, u32 port_bit) xhci_test_and_clear_bit() argument 740 xhci_hub_report_usb3_link_state(struct xhci_hcd *xhci, u32 *status, u32 status_reg) xhci_hub_report_usb3_link_state() argument 800 xhci_del_comp_mod_timer(struct xhci_hcd *xhci, u32 status, u16 wIndex) xhci_del_comp_mod_timer() argument 826 struct xhci_hcd *xhci; xhci_handle_usb2_port_link_resume() local 932 struct xhci_hcd *xhci; xhci_get_usb3_port_status() local 1095 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_hub_control() local 1540 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_hub_status_data() local 1611 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_bus_suspend() local 1769 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_bus_resume() local [all...] |
H A D | xhci-debugfs.c | 86 static struct xhci_regset *xhci_debugfs_alloc_regset(struct xhci_hcd *xhci) in xhci_debugfs_alloc_regset() argument 114 static void xhci_debugfs_regset(struct xhci_hcd *xhci, u32 base, in xhci_debugfs_regset() argument 141 static void xhci_debugfs_extcap_regset(struct xhci_hcd *xhci, int cap_id, in xhci_debugfs_extcap_regset() argument 261 struct xhci_hcd *xhci; xhci_slot_context_show() local 283 struct xhci_hcd *xhci; xhci_endpoint_context_show() local 368 struct xhci_hcd *xhci = hcd_to_xhci(port->rhub->hcd); xhci_port_write() local 406 xhci_debugfs_create_files(struct xhci_hcd *xhci, struct xhci_file_map *files, size_t nentries, void *data, struct dentry *parent, const struct file_operations *fops) xhci_debugfs_create_files() argument 418 xhci_debugfs_create_ring_dir(struct xhci_hcd *xhci, struct xhci_ring **ring, const char *name, struct dentry *parent) xhci_debugfs_create_ring_dir() argument 432 xhci_debugfs_create_context_files(struct xhci_hcd *xhci, struct dentry *parent, int slot_id) xhci_debugfs_create_context_files() argument 444 xhci_debugfs_create_endpoint(struct xhci_hcd *xhci, struct xhci_virt_device *dev, int ep_index) xhci_debugfs_create_endpoint() argument 471 xhci_debugfs_remove_endpoint(struct xhci_hcd *xhci, struct xhci_virt_device *dev, int ep_index) xhci_debugfs_remove_endpoint() argument 567 xhci_debugfs_create_stream_files(struct xhci_hcd *xhci, struct xhci_virt_device *dev, int ep_index) xhci_debugfs_create_stream_files() argument 592 xhci_debugfs_create_slot(struct xhci_hcd *xhci, int slot_id) xhci_debugfs_create_slot() argument 612 xhci_debugfs_remove_slot(struct xhci_hcd *xhci, int slot_id) xhci_debugfs_remove_slot() argument 632 xhci_debugfs_create_ports(struct xhci_hcd *xhci, struct dentry *parent) xhci_debugfs_create_ports() argument 653 xhci_debugfs_init(struct xhci_hcd *xhci) xhci_debugfs_init() argument 705 xhci_debugfs_exit(struct xhci_hcd *xhci) xhci_debugfs_exit() argument [all...] |
H A D | xhci-pci.c | 89 static int xhci_pci_reinit(struct xhci_hcd *xhci, struct pci_dev *pdev) in xhci_pci_reinit() argument 105 static void xhci_pci_quirks(struct device *dev, struct xhci_hcd *xhci) in xhci_pci_quirks() argument 371 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_find_lpm_incapable_ports() local 405 struct xhci_hcd *xhci; xhci_pci_setup() local 449 struct xhci_hcd *xhci; xhci_pci_probe() local 528 struct xhci_hcd *xhci; xhci_pci_remove() local 566 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_ssic_port_unused_quirk() local 601 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_pme_quirk() local 622 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_pci_suspend() local 651 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_pci_resume() local 690 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_pci_shutdown() local [all...] |
H A D | xhci-mtk-sch.c | 77 static int get_bw_index(struct xhci_hcd *xhci, struct usb_device *udev, in get_bw_index() argument 654 struct xhci_hcd *xhci = hcd_to_xhci(mtk->hcd); in xhci_mtk_sch_init() local 687 struct xhci_hcd *xhci; in xhci_mtk_add_ep_quirk() local 733 struct xhci_hcd *xhci; xhci_mtk_drop_ep_quirk() local 769 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_mtk_check_bandwidth() local 818 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_mtk_reset_bandwidth() local [all...] |
/kernel/linux/linux-5.10/drivers/usb/cdns3/ |
H A D | host.c | 33 struct platform_device *xhci; in __cdns3_host_init() local 92 struct xhci_hcd *xhci = hcd_to_xhci(hcd); xhci_cdns3_suspend_quirk() local [all...] |
/kernel/linux/linux-5.10/drivers/usb/dwc3/ |
H A D | host.c | 48 struct platform_device *xhci; in dwc3_host_init() local [all...] |
/kernel/linux/linux-6.6/drivers/usb/dwc3/ |
H A D | host.c | 65 struct platform_device *xhci; in dwc3_host_init() local [all...] |
/kernel/linux/linux-6.6/drivers/usb/cdns3/ |
H A D | host.c | 34 struct xhci_hcd *xhci = hcd_to_xhci(hcd); in xhci_cdns3_plat_start() local 69 struct platform_device *xhci; in __cdns_host_init() local [all...] |